$(function(){

    $("ul.dropdown li").hover(function(){
    
        $(this).addClass("hover");
        $('ul:first',this).css('visibility', 'visible');
    
    }, function(){
    
        $(this).removeClass("hover");
        $('ul:first',this).css('visibility', 'hidden');
    
    });
    
    $("ul.dropdown li ul li:has(ul)").find("a:first").append(" &raquo; ");

    // My additions
    // Only top level without childern
    $('ul.dropdown li[id^="item"]:not(:has(ul))').addClass("allround"); 
    // Only top level that have children
    $('ul.dropdown li[id^="item"]:has(ul)').addClass("topround");
    // Only children that are first
    $("ul.dropdown li.first").addClass("toprightround");
    // Only children that are last
    $("ul.dropdown li.last").addClass("bottomround");
});
